Get to know

Redhill

Perfectly situated between London and Brighton, with direct rail links into the city and easy access to the M25, leafy Redhill really is the ideal commuter town. In fact, the high street is currently being redeveloped to meet the needs of an influx of metropolitan London buyers.

You’ll find a mix of period properties and modern developments in a beautiful rural setting, with the characterful villages of South Nut field and Bletchingley adding a touch of history to the area. If you’d like to get closer to nature, you’ll find country walks in Gatton Park and Redhill Common right on your doorstep
